Cropper Residence: Gamaliel KY Died: Wednesday, 26 July 1995, T J Samson Community Hospital in Glasgow KY, extended illness, age 73. Retired farmer, sawmill operator, had been a partner in Cropper Brother Lumber Co. U S Army veteran of WW II where he was a Corporal serving the 37th Combat Engineeres. Participated in the D-Day invasion of Omaha Beach, was awarded four Bronze Stars during his three years of service. Son of the late Bruce and Melia Ann Sadler Cropper Survivors: Wife: Olene Cornwell Cropper Son: Jerry L Cropper of Gamaliel Brother: Alvin Ray Cropper of Gamaliel Several nieces and nephews Preceded also in death by: Brothers; Winfred and Clyde Cropper Sister: Bessie Driver Services: 1 pm Saturday, 29 July 1995, Strode's Gamaliel Chapel, burial location missing.
